Mission
Canton challenger baseball is a special needs division of little league baseball. Challenger baseball is a program of organized baseball for children with special needs, ages 4 through 18, or 22 if still enrolled in high school. We now offer a senior league for players 16 years and older. From spina bifida to down syndrome, developmental disabilities to autism or adhd, every child deserves to play and with the challenger league no child is ever turned away.
